Nestled within the serene landscape of Moorhead, Minnesota, where the Red River quietly marks the border with North Dakota, Concordia College operates as a distinctive thread in the fabric of American liberal arts education. To view it merely as another small Midwestern college would be to overlook the profound and quiet resonance of its mission, one deeply intertwined with a particular ethos of inquiry, community, and global citizenship that defies easy categorization.

The identity of Concordia is fundamentally shaped by its affiliation with the Evangelical Lutheran Church in America. This connection is not a restrictive dogmatic boundary, but rather a foundational spirit that colors its approach. It fosters an environment where questions of meaning, value, and service are considered legitimate and vital dimensions of a rigorous education. The campus culture implicitly asks not just what one can do, but for what purpose and for whom. This creates a unique intellectual climate where a biology student might grapple with the ethics of genetic research, or an economics major consider the human impact of market forces, all within a framework that welcomes dialogue between faith and reason.

Academically, Concordia champions the classic liberal arts model with a notably purposeful execution. Its curriculum is designed to build connections, challenging the modern tendency toward intellectual silos. A distinctive cornerstone is the Concordia Language Villages, a program of international renown that extends far beyond the campus. While headquartered here, the Villages are a world unto themselves, immersing learners of all ages in complete linguistic and cultural environments, from the Japanese *mura* to the German *Waldsee*. This extraordinary initiative reflects the college’s core belief that understanding across human differences is not an elective, but a necessity. It translates a global perspective from abstract concept into lived, tangible experience, influencing the entire college’s outlook.

The campus itself functions as a deliberate ecosystem for holistic development. Residential life is emphasized, creating a dense network of relationships where learning continues in dormitories, dining halls, and shared spaces. The famed Cobber tradition—a nickname derived from the school’s corn-husking past—fosters a sense of shared identity that is more about mutual support than mere rivalry. This close-knit community provides a safe harbor for the intellectual and personal risk-taking that true education requires. Students are known not as numbers, but as individuals by their professors, creating mentorship bonds that often last decades.

Furthermore, Concordia’s commitment to place is striking. It engages deeply with the Fargo-Moorhead community, not as an isolated academic island, but as an active participant. Students apply their learning through sustained service projects, clinical placements, business internships, and artistic collaborations within the region. This rootedness in the local provides a realistic grounding for its global aspirations, teaching students that responsible citizenship begins in one’s immediate context.

Yet, for all its focus on community and place, the college deliberately stretches the horizons of its students. Study away participation is remarkably high, with programs designed to be integrative, not merely touristic. Whether conducting environmental research in Norway, studying political systems in Costa Rica, or exploring religious history in Turkey, students are pushed to see their home and themselves through a new lens. This combination of deep roots and wide wings is a calculated and effective educational philosophy.

In an era where higher education is increasingly pressured to justify itself through narrow metrics of job placement and starting salaries, Concordia College offers a compelling counter-narrative. It asserts that the most practical education may indeed be one that cultivates adaptable minds, empathetic hearts, and a sense of vocational purpose. It produces not just graduates, but translators—individuals capable of translating complex ideas across disciplines, cultures, and value systems.

The quiet power of Concordia lies in this integration. It seamlessly blends the reflective depth of its Lutheran heritage with the expansive reach of a globalized curriculum. It pairs the personal attention of a residential community with the professional rigor of its academic programs. It holds in creative tension the importance of being from somewhere specific while preparing students to engage with a world that is endlessly interconnected. The result is an educational experience that is both timeless and urgently relevant, a small college on the northern plains quietly shaping individuals who think deeply, serve responsibly, and lead with integrity in a complex world.
